/** * @typedef {import('./cart').CartData} CartData * @typedef {import('./cart').CartShippingAddress} CartShippingAddress */ /** * @typedef {Object} StoreCart * * @property {Array} cartCoupons An array of coupons applied * to the cart. * @property {Array} cartItems An array of items in the * cart. * @property {number} cartItemsCount The number of items in the * cart. * @property {number} cartItemsWeight The weight of all items in * the cart. * @property {boolean} cartNeedsPayment True when the cart will * require payment. * @property {boolean} cartNeedsShipping True when the cart will * require shipping. * @property {Array} cartItemErrors Item validation errors. * @property {Object} cartTotals Cart and line total * amounts. * @property {boolean} cartIsLoading True when cart data is * being loaded. * @property {Array} cartErrors An array of errors thrown * by the cart. * @property {CartShippingAddress} shippingAddress Shipping address for the * cart. * @property {Array} shippingRates array of selected shipping * rates. * @property {boolean} shippingRatesLoading Whether or not the * shipping rates are * being loaded. * @property {boolean} hasShippingAddress Whether or not the cart * has a shipping address yet. * @property {function(Object):any} receiveCart Dispatcher to receive * updated cart. */ /** * @typedef {Object} StoreCartCoupon * * @property {Array} appliedCoupons Collection of applied coupons from the * API. * @property {boolean} isLoading True when coupon data is being loaded. * @property {Function} applyCoupon Callback for applying a coupon by code. * @property {Function} removeCoupon Callback for removing a coupon by code. * @property {boolean} isApplyingCoupon True when a coupon is being applied. * @property {boolean} isRemovingCoupon True when a coupon is being removed. */ /** * @typedef {Object} StoreCartItemAddToCart * * @property {number} cartQuantity The quantity of the item in the * cart. * @property {boolean} addingToCart Whether the cart item is still * being added or not. * @property {boolean} cartIsLoading Whether the cart is being loaded. * @property {Function} addToCart Callback for adding a cart item. */ /** * @typedef {Object} StoreCartItemQuantity * * @property {number} quantity The quantity of the item in the * cart. * @property {boolean} isPendingDelete Whether the cart item is being * deleted or not. * @property {Function} changeQuantity Callback for changing quantity * of item in cart. * @property {Function} removeItem Callback for removing a cart item. * @property {Object} cartItemQuantityErrors An array of errors thrown by * the cart. */ /** * @typedef {Object} EmitResponseTypes * * @property {string} SUCCESS To indicate a success response. * @property {string} FAIL To indicate a failed response. * @property {string} ERROR To indicate an error response. */ /** * @typedef {Object} NoticeContexts * * @property {string} PAYMENTS Notices for the payments step. * @property {string} EXPRESS_PAYMENTS Notices for the express payments step. */ /* eslint-disable jsdoc/valid-types */ // Enum format below triggers the above rule even though VSCode interprets it fine. /** * @typedef {NoticeContexts['PAYMENTS']|NoticeContexts['EXPRESS_PAYMENTS']} NoticeContextsEnum */ /** * @typedef {Object} EmitSuccessResponse * * @property {EmitResponseTypes['SUCCESS']} type Should have the value of * EmitResponseTypes.SUCCESS. * @property {string} [redirectUrl] If the redirect url should be changed set * this. Note, this is ignored for some * emitters. * @property {Object} [meta] Additional data returned for the success * response. This varies between context * emitters. */ /** * @typedef {Object} EmitFailResponse * * @property {EmitResponseTypes['FAIL']} type Should have the value of * EmitResponseTypes.FAIL * @property {string} message A message to trigger a notice for. * @property {NoticeContextsEnum} [messageContext] What context to display any message in. * @property {Object} [meta] Additional data returned for the fail * response. This varies between context * emitters. */ /** * @typedef {Object} EmitErrorResponse * * @property {EmitResponseTypes['ERROR']} type Should have the value of * EmitResponseTypes.ERROR * @property {string} message A message to trigger a notice for. * @property {boolean} retry If false, then it means an * irrecoverable error so don't allow for * shopper to retry checkout (which may * mean either a different payment or * fixing validation errors). * @property {Object} [validationErrors] If provided, will be set as validation * errors in the validation context. * @property {NoticeContextsEnum} [messageContext] What context to display any message in. * @property {Object} [meta] Additional data returned for the fail * response. This varies between context * emitters. */ /* eslint-enable jsdoc/valid-types */ /** * @typedef {Object} EmitResponseApi * * @property {EmitResponseTypes} responseTypes An object of various response types that can * be used in returned response objects. * @property {NoticeContexts} noticeContexts An object of various notice contexts that can * be used for targeting where a notice appears. * @property {function(Object):boolean} shouldRetry Returns whether the user is allowed to retry * the payment after a failed one. * @property {function(Object):boolean} isSuccessResponse Returns whether the given response is of a * success response type. * @property {function(Object):boolean} isErrorResponse Returns whether the given response is of an * error response type. * @property {function(Object):boolean} isFailResponse Returns whether the given response is of a * fail response type. */ export {}; /** * Internal dependencies */ import { ACTION_TYPES as types } from './action-types'; /** * Action creator for setting a single query-state value for a given context. * * @param {string} context Context for query state being stored. * @param {string} queryKey Key for query item. * @param {*} value The value for the query item. * * @return {Object} The action object. */ export const setQueryValue = ( context, queryKey, value ) => { return { type: types.SET_QUERY_KEY_VALUE, context, queryKey, value, }; }; /** * Action creator for setting query-state for a given context. * * @param {string} context Context for query state being stored. * @param {*} value Query state being stored for the given context. * * @return {Object} The action object. */ export const setValueForQueryContext = ( context, value ) => { return { type: types.SET_QUERY_CONTEXT_VALUE, context, value, }; };

Cửa Hàng Phụ Kiện Camera

Phụ kiện camera đa dạng, chính hãng, giá tốt

Как создать криптокошелек в 2024 Exnode на vc ru - Cửa Hàng Phụ Kiện Camera

Как создать криптокошелек в 2024 Exnode на vc ru

Чтобы перейти в меню настроек Wallet, нужно нажать три вертикальные точки в правом верхнем углу. Там можно выбрать валюту, в которой будет показан ваш баланс, а также валюту платежа. Так пользователи платят за различные продукты https://www.xcritical.com/ криптовалютой, не переходя в другие приложения. Кроме того в Wallet встроена P2P-площадка, на которой можно покупать и продавать криптовалюту без ограничений, которые есть на некоторых криптобиржах. У все большего числа пользователей в настройках появляется вкладка «Кошелек» или Wallet. Это такой бот, с помощью которого можно проводить операции с криптовалютой.

  • В одном из первых предстоящих обновлений разработчики TON Space обещают внедрить поддержку стейкинга.
  • Потому что манипуляции с криптовалютой на биржах уже научились отслеживать.
  • Это возможно, если должник хранит свою криптовалюту на криптобирже (кастодиальном кошельке).
  • Многие криптокошельки позволяют настраивать сумму комиссии.
  • Подтвердить место жительства можно с помощью документов не старше 3 месяцев, на которых видно полное имя и текущий адрес проживания пользователя.
  • Они довольно просты в использовании и поэтому более популярны.
  • С ноября 2023 года «Телеграм» постепенно внедряет в мессенджер полноценный криптовалютный кошелек.

Мои адреса для получения постоянно меняются. Это нормально?

В зависимости от способа хранения приватных ключей кошельки могут быть кастодиальными и некастодиальными. Wallet Pay предлагается подключить к боту, чтобы принимать и обрабатывать платежи в криптовалюте. С 12 июня все платежи за цифровые какой биткоин кошелек выбрать товары и услуги проводятся в Telegram с помощью Telegram Stars. Продать криптовалюту можно через P2P-маркет, либо вкладку обмена, где обменять ее на стейблкоин, например, на USDT.

Инструкция по созданию криптокошелька

С ноября 2023 года «Телеграм» постепенно внедряет в мессенджер полноценный криптовалютный кошелек. Соблюдение этих рекомендаций поможет вам безопасно и эффективно использовать ваш криптокошелек. Криптокошелек — это действительно цифровой инструмент, который играет ключевую роль в управлении криптовалютами. Позвольте объяснить его функции и виды более подробно и доступно.

Что такое TON Space в «Кошельке»

Такие кошельки часто создается на базе бирж (Binance, KuCoin, Huobi) и дают доступ к финансовым продуктам биржи (торги, стейкинг, торговля на фьючерсах). Есть и “легкие” десктопные кошельки, для использования которых не нужно скачивать весь блокчейн. Его основная часть хранится на сторонних серверах, к которым подключен кошелек, а клиентская часть хранит только собственные транзакции. Глобально криптокошельки можно разделить на холодные и горячие.

Как работает кошелек TON в Telegram и для чего он может понадобиться

После покупки вы можете импортировать свой старый криптокошелек в новое устройство, используя seed-фразу из 24 слов, которую вы сохраняли ранее. Мы подготовили для вас чек-лист, по которому можно проверить, насколько вы обезопасили свои средства от возможного взлома. Если вы обнаружили, что соответствуете каждому из них, поздравляем – ваши средства в безопасности. После отправки она отобразится в общем списке, где отображаются входящие и исходящие транзакции.

Как завести криптокошелек и платить картой в криптовалюте

Транзакции подписываются с помощью приватных или закрытых ключей, которые позволяют тратить монет. В этом разделе мы расскажем, как создать биткоин-кошелек, и продемонстрируем все этапы регистрации с самого начала на примере популярных криптокошельков. Как правило, для большинства клиентов процесс создания идентичен и отличается только несколькими специфическими для них этапами.

как открыть криптокошелек

Что если файл кошелька будет удален?

Чтобы отправить TON на криптобиржу необходимо указать комментарий. Нужный тег или мемо будет обозначен в профиле на криптобирже, на который будет переводиться криптовалюта. Спустя практически два года — в ноябре 2023 года функция криптокошелька появилась у всех пользователей за пределами США и некоторых других стран. В России, например, она доступна практически в полном объеме. Вопрос безопасности играет первостепенную роль при выборе криптокошелька. Классификация криптокошельков по способу подключения на горячие (онлайн) и холодные (офлайн) частично дает ответ на него.

Как создать мобильный криптокошелек

Только вы должны знать, где он находится, в противном случае сторонние лица смогут получить полный контроль над вашими средствами. Хороший кошелек обеспечивает высокий уровень безопасности при хранении криптовалюты. Например, ПО может шифровать данные, применять сложные алгоритмы аутентификации. Холодный кошелек работает в автономном режиме, то есть не требует постоянного подключения к интернету. Это материальные носители информации, которые можно хранить в сейфе.

Дополнительные возможности кошелька: TON Space и Wallet Pay

Ключ – это длинная последовательность случайных символов. Открытый ключ можно сравнить с номером банковского счета – ничего страшного не произойдет, если кто-то узнает его. А вот закрытый ключ, скорее, похож на PIN-код или одноразовый пароль для доступа к этому счету, и беречь его надо как зеницу ока. Для торговли валютой и хранения небольших сумм можно использовать кастодиальные кошельки, выпуском которых занимаются специальные сервисы. В этом случае фактически доступ к кошельку также есть у владельцев сервиса, поэтому выбирать сервис необходимо с учетом его репутации и отзывов пользователей.

Да, поэтому перед выбором нужно изучить отзывы и рекомендации. Для хранения активов важно использовать общеизвестные приложения и устройства. На главной странице приложения нужно выбрать пункт «Обменять».

как открыть криптокошелек

Один из самых известных экспертов по биткоину и блокчейну Андреас Антонопулос сказал, что «Криптовалютный кошелек – это интерфейс между пользователем и блокчейном». Другими словами, кошельки выступают программной оболочкой и позволяют совершать транзакции, транслируемые в блокчейн-сеть. Сначала нужно открыть биткоин-кошелек, получить адрес и уточнить сумму сделки.

Допустим, вы купили биткоины в обменнике и вам нужно получить адрес вашего биткоин-кошелька. Рассмотрим как это сделать на примере криптокошелька Exodus. Запустите программу и перейдите в раздел «Wallet», расположенный в верхнем меню. Менее популярный обозреватель с красивым и интуитивно-понятным интерфейсом, который отображает визуально загруженность сети в виде блоков. Так пользователи могут сразу посмотреть основную информацию не только по последнему блоку, но и предыдущим, а также тем, что еще не были добавлены.

Это означает, что приватный ключ хранится только у пользователя. Данный кошелек позволяет хранить, отправлять и получать TON, USDT, NOT, жетоны и NFT на блокчейне TON. Также внутри сервиса есть вкладка «Стейкинг TON», которая предлагает годовую доходность до 3,06% (по данным на июль 2024 года).

Баланс обычно отображается на главной странице интерфейса. Если вы только что провели транзакцию и баланс не обновился, подождите некоторое время, так как обновления в блокчейне могут занять время. В полях нужно ввести сумму монет, а затем адрес получателя. Если вы пользуетесь мобильным приложением, то проще сканировать QR-код или платежный запрос. Многие криптокошельки позволяют настраивать сумму комиссии.

В криптоиндустрии работает немало мошенников или хакеров, которые взламывают криптокошельки. Также рекомендуем использовать надежную антивирусную защиту и не переходить по неизвестным ссылкам. Помните, что ответственность за сохранность своих активов несете только Вы. В криптовалютном сообществе нет контролирующих “банковских” органов, которые смогут отменить совершенную транзакцию. Вы также не сможете обратиться в полицию, если мошенники взломают кошелек.

Main Menu